What is a Pro Daily Weather Forecast?

A pro daily weather forecast offers in-depth weather data catering to specific needs, including detailed temperature trends, precipitation probabilities, and alerts for severe weather conditions. For individuals or businesses that rely on accurate weather predictions to make informed decisions, these comprehensive forecasts are essential. Professionals in industries such as agriculture, travel, and event planning particularly value such insights.

What Features Are Common in Pro Daily Weather Forecasts?

Pro weather forecasts typically include:

  • Real-time Radar Updates: Assess current weather conditions through visual maps.
  • Severe Weather Alerts: Receive notifications about hazardous conditions, such as hurricanes, tornadoes, and severe thunderstorms.
  • Longer Forecast Horizons: Availability of 14-day forecasts for extended planning.
  • Historical Weather Data: Insights into weather patterns over previous years, aiding in predictive analysis.
  • Multiple Environmental Layers: Access to additional data points, such as air quality indices and wildfire zones, providing a holistic view of environmental trends.

Considerations When Choosing a Weather App

When selecting a pro daily weather forecasting tool, consider:

  • Specific Use Cases: Determine whether you need detailed radar capabilities, alert systems, or general forecasts.
  • User Experience: Some users prefer an easy interface focused on core functionalities, while others may want comprehensive tools with various features.
  • Budget: Assess what you are willing to spend on forecast tools, as some may require ongoing subscriptions for premium features.
